The United Arab Emirates Veterinary Vaccines Market is projected to witness mixed growth rate patterns during 2025 to 2029. The growth rate begins at 14.67% in 2025, climbs to a high of 15.77% in 2026, and moderates to 10.46% by 2029.
The United Arab Emirates (UAE) Veterinary Vaccines market has witnessed significant growth, driven by the country`s increasing focus on animal health and the growing need to prevent and control infectious diseases in livestock and pets. Veterinary vaccines play a crucial role in safeguarding animal health, improving livestock productivity, and preventing the transmission of zoonotic diseases. The UAE thriving agriculture and livestock sector, the rising pet ownership, and the government`s initiatives to enhance animal welfare have contributed to the rising demand for veterinary vaccines in the country.
Several factors have fueled the demand for veterinary vaccines in the UAE. Firstly, the country`s agriculture sector`s growth and the importance of livestock as a source of food and income have driven the demand for vaccines to protect animals from infectious diseases, such as foot-and-mouth disease and avian influenza. Secondly, the increasing pet ownership and the desire to ensure the health and well-being of companion animals have led to higher demand for vaccines against diseases like rabies and canine distemper. Additionally, the UAE government`s efforts to control zoonotic diseases and promote animal health through vaccination programs have further boosted the demand for veterinary vaccines.
Despite its growth, the UAE Veterinary Vaccines market faces certain challenges. One major challenge is the need for continuous research and development to address evolving disease challenges and develop effective vaccines for new and emerging diseases. Veterinary vaccine manufacturers need to invest in cutting-edge technologies and collaborate with research institutions to stay ahead of disease outbreaks and maintain the efficacy of their products. Moreover, the complex regulatory landscape and the need for stringent quality control measures present challenges to vaccine manufacturers and importers.
The Covid-19 pandemic had a significant impact on the UAE Veterinary Vaccines market. While the pandemic primarily affected human health, it also highlighted the importance of animal health and the need for effective vaccination programs to prevent zoonotic diseases. The veterinary sector adapted to the pandemic by implementing safety measures, including telemedicine consultations and vaccine delivery, to continue providing essential services to pet owners and livestock farmers.
In the UAE Veterinary Vaccines market, several key players have a significant presence. Companies such as Merck & Co., Inc., Zoetis Inc., and Boehringer Ingelheim International GmbH are among the major contributors to the market, supplying a wide range of veterinary vaccines for various species, including livestock, poultry, and companion animals.
